TH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F FRESNO RESOLVES AS FOLLOWS:
SECTION 1
That the rates of pay to be paid to certain employees of. the City
of Fresno allocated to the classes specified herein which are sub-
ject to the provisions of the second paragraph of Section 809 of
the Charter of the City of Fresno are established as provided in
this resolution.
SECTION 2.
Paid holidays for employees in the following classes shall be as
listed`
Concrete Finisher, Air Conditioning Mechanic, Construction Equip-
ment Operator, Hod Carrier, Pipefitter,, and Water Distribution
Supervisor I: Lincoln's Birthday, Admission Day, Columbus Day,
Veterans Day, (Employee's Birthday)
Electrician's assistant, Electrician, Utility Electrician, Elec-
trician Supervisor I and Fainter: Lincoln's Birthday, Washington's
Birthday, Admission Day,, Columbus Day, (Employee's Birthday).
Stone Mason., Stone Mason Supervisor I: Lincoln's Birthday,
Washington's Birthday, Admission Day, Columbus Day, Veterans
Day, (Employee's B rthday) ,
SECTION 3»
,lob .Code Medical Standard
Concrete Finisher $11.90 an hoar rT 93 B
Hours of Work: 8 hours per day, 5 days per week, Monday 'to
Friday inclusive,
For any extra time worked up to a total of
2 hours after the regular 8 hours , have been
worked between the hoursaof 8:00 a.m and
4:30 p.m on Monday through Friday, time
and one-half the straight time rate shall
be paid. All overtime in addition to the
2 hours above described shall be paid at
double time, including all work on Saturdays,
ra - Sundays and holidays. When men are required
to report for work before 8 . t0 0 a.m. they
shall be paid double time prior to 8:00 a.m.
except when it is desirable to start the work
day earlier due to existing traffic, weather,
or similar conditions,
Vacation.
$1.80 per hour worked or paid in addition to
the above wages shall be paid by the City to
the Vacation Trust Fund for use by the affected
employee when vacation is taken
Shaw -Up Time:
Any worker reporting for work at the regular
starting time and for whom no work is provided
shall receive pay for 2 hours at the stipulated
rate ` for so reporting unless he has been notified
before the end of his/her preceding shift not to
report, and any employee who reports to work and
for whom work is provided shall receive not less
than 4 hours pay and if more than 4 hours are
worked in any one day shall not receive less
than full.. d:ay ' s pay therefore, unless prevented:
from working for reasons beyond the control of
the City of Fresno, including, but not limited,,
by such factors or inclement weather, or break-
down causing discontinuance of a major unit of
the project during which time workers are not
required or requested to remain on the jab by
the City of Fresno.
SECTION 4.
Job Code Medical Standard
Air Conditioning
Mechanic-
$15.00 a.n hour V 23
Hours of Work:
The regular work week shall consist of forty
40) hours Monday 8 00 a.m. through Friday
4 A 3 (3 p.m., and the regular work day shall con-
sist of 8 hours, Monday through Friday between
the hours of 8:00 a.m. and 4:30 p.m., with a
lunch period of not more than cane -half hour,'
nor less than one-half hour, between the hours
of 12 o'clock noon and 1: 04 p.m.
overtime
All time worked in excess of the regular work
day or the regular work week, or 'before the
start or after the end: of the . regular work day,
as provided herein, and all work performed on
Saturdays, Sundays, and holidays shall constitute
overtime and shall be paid at double the straight
time rate, except that all such overtime on
jobbing and repair work shall be paid at one
and one-half times the straight time rate.
-2 .
Vacation:
$1..00 per hour worked or paid shall be withheld
from the hourly wage by the City and transmitted
to the Vacation Trust Fund for use by the affected
employee when vacation is taken.
Show -Up Time:
Any worker reporting for work at the regular
starting time and for whom no work is provided
shall receive pay for 4 hours at the prevailing
rate of - wages unless notifiednot to report,
and any worker' who reports to work and for ;whom
work is provided shall receive not less than
4 hours pay and if more than 4 hours are worked
in any one day, shall receive not less than a
full day's pay. However., the exception shall
be when weather makes it impracticable to put
such an employee to work or when stoppage of
work is occasioned thereby or when a worker
leaves his/her work of his/her own accord.
SECTION 5
Grob Code Medical Standard,
Electrician's Assistant $13.98 an hour U 41 B
Electrician
$14.80 an. hour U 43 B
Utility Electrician
$14.80 an hour U 44 B
Electrician Supervisor .1 $16.28 an hour U 48
Utility Electrician working on poles at a height
of 75 feet or more; on towers at a height of 100
feet or more, on other than a tower erection,
shall receive double time rate of pay for all such
k
time worked on such heights. Thirty minutes or
more of such work shall entitle the Utility Elec-
trician to the 'premium rate for that half day.
Work performed in trees shall receive time and
one-half up to 60 feet. Work in excess of 60
feet, double time.
Hours of Work;
Eight hours between the hours of 8:00 a.m. and
12:00 noon and 12 30 p.m. and 4:30 p.m. shall
constitute a wcrk day. Forty hours work within
5 days, Monday through Friday inclusive shall
constitute'a week's work. harking hours may be
changed to conform to weather conditions.
Overtime.
All work: performed outside the regularly sched-
uled working hours and on Saturdays., Sundays
-
and holidays shall be paid for at double the
rate of pay,
Vacation,:
An amount equal to 12% of the employee's gross
wage shall be deducted from the net wage by the
City and transmitted to the Vacation Trust Fund:
for use by the affected employee when vacation
s taken.
Show-UpTime: When workers, other than Utility Electricians,
are directed to report on ;a. job and do not start
work due to weather conditions, lack of material
or other causes beyond their control, they shah,
receive 2 hours pay unless notified before
7 00 a.m,
When _Utility Electricians are directed to report
on a job and do not start work due to weather
conditions, lack of ma.•terial, or other causes
beyond their control, they shall receive 4 hours
pay "unless notified before 7: 00 a.m.

Hours of Work: Bight hours per day,. 5 days per week, Monday
through Friday inclusive. 1f an employee works in �
two or more classifications during any work day or
shift, he shall receive the rate of the highest
paid classification on which he has been: so em-
ployed for the full day or shift.
Overtime: For all work performed after 8 hours in any one
day or after 7 hours, or 7k hours where required
by shift operationsand. on Saturdays,, time and
one-half shall be paid Work performed on Sundays
and holidays shall be paid at double time.
Shift; Where single shifts' are worked., etarting time shall
be at 7: 0`0, 7: 30 r or 8 00 a.m. S'tarti times for
the afternoon shifts shall: be adjusted to the morn-
ing starting time.
-4
where two shifts are worked, the first shift
shall work 71z hours and shall receive the
straight time rate for 8 hours and the second
shift shall work. 7 hours and shall receive the
regular straight time rate for 8 hours.
When three shifts are worked:, each shift shall
provide 7 hours work for 8 hours pay.
Vacation: $1.00 per hour worked or paid in addition to
the above wages shall be paid by the City to
the Vacation. Trust Fund for use by the affected
employee when vacation is -taken.
Show -Up Time: All employees :shall be paid for not less than
one-half day x s work if working 4 hours or less
and not lessthan a full day's pay if working
more than 4 hours, except when.climatic con-
ditions interfere with the work, in ,which event
work beyond the first half day shall be com-
puted by the hour and half hour. This provision
shall apply to work on Saturdays, Sundays, and:
holidays, as well as work on regular work days.
An employee shall be notified at the end of his
shift if he is not required to work, the follow-
ing d.ay. -In the event an employee , is not so
notified and. ,reports for work', but is not given
any work, he shall be paid for two (2 ) hours for
such loss of time. In. the event of inclement
weather or breakdown of equipment, the Cite,
unless a lesser period is agreed to, may give
said notice by mutually agreed upon method not
less than two (2) hours prior to an employee's
regularstarting time.

In case an employee works on more than one ciassx-,_
ficatien or kind of work in any one day or shift, ,-_.-
he/she shall receive the rate of the highest paid
classification on which he/she has been employed
for the full day.
Hours of Work.
Eight hours per day, 5 days per week', Monday
through Friday inclusive. The regular starting
time shall be 8:00`a.m. Where existing weather
or traffic conditions render it.desirable to start
the ,day shift at an earlier hour such starting
time may be made earler by mutual consent. In
such events the starting time agreed to must con-
tinue for the duration of the job or until changed
by mutual consent.
Overtime:
Double the regular hourly rate shall be paid for
all wore performed on Sundays and holidays. One
and one-half times : the regular hourly rate shall
be paid for ` all work performed before a shift
begins and after it ends and for all Saturday work.
Vacations
$1.15 per hour worked or paid in addition -the above
wages shall be paid by the City to the Vacation
Trust Fund for use by the affected employee when
vacation is taken,
Show -Up Time:
When a 'worker is called out to work on Saturdays
Sundays or holidays, he/she shall be paid at
least 4`hours at the applicable overtime rate.
All time worked beyond the first consecutive
hours on Saturday, Sunday and holidays shall be
reckoned by the hour at the applicable overtime
rate,

Hours of Work:
Eight hours per day, 5 days per week, Monday
through Friday inclusive.
Overtime:
Work done before 8:00 a.m. and after 5:00 p.m.
and on Saturdays and Sundays shall be considered
overtime and shall be paid, at the rate of double
time.
Vacation:
$1.00 per hour worked or paid shall be withheld
from the hourly wage by the City and transmitted
to the Vacation Trust Fund for use by the affected
employee when vacation is taken.
Show -Up Time:
.Any worker required to report on the job and not
put to work shall be paid two hours show --up time,
inclement weather excepted.
Any worker who works after 10:00 a.m. and is them
dismissed, shall be paid for a full half -day.
Any worker working after 8:00 p.m. who has com
menced work at 8:00 a.m. of the same day shall
be paid for a full-8 hours, unless the lay-off
is due to the lack of material due to causes
beyond the control of the City of Fresno.
